Transaction 7518bdf95c06cb1f8a63ea01273f8a4c811fc8495c15c73e15c3d250f7e2b042

2 Input
1 Outputs
  • 7518bdf95c06cb1f8a63ea01273f8a4c811fc8495c15c73e15c3d250f7e2b042:0
  • value  1656772
    address  38ruM4ByULeP61TyQMaugri7MmVERXN4uC